The Importance of a Scholarship

A scholarship is a grant or payment made to support a student's education, awarded on the basis of academics or other achievements. Pretty much every young adult knows that a scholarship is able to pay for their tuition, books, and primary living expense. Not only does a scholarship help pay toward current and future fees, it can also look good on a student's resume, leading to working at a well-paying job. Once a student graduates from college with a scholarship, potential employers will be very impressed with reading the resumes of these students. Students that have earned a scholarship shows representatives that they have discipline and responsibility by being able to get the award. An applicant who obtained their education via a scholarship is highly respected in the eyes of most potential employers.
